Just got this in today and very disappointed. It kept hanging up on my release button for the cylinder. The spring was stiff and sometimes it would not release the rounds. I compared them to my moon clips when it comes to speed. I timed it in loading them and installing them into the cylinder to see which was the fastest. The moon clips were faster by a few seconds. If you have the proper loading for the moon clips they are just as fast as the speed loader. However, speed beez they are expensive. I timed the speed beez loader all 8 rounds and it took about 12 seconds. I did the same with BMT speed loader and they were just as fast using their loader. Several trails were made using the speed loader from speed beez and BMT. The moon clips were faster loading about 3-4 seconds compare to speed beez. Also I had trouble trying to line up all 8 rounds using speed beez at times. They were times they even got stuck. Not for sure if I am the only one having trouble with this. I have had other speed loader with out any issue. However those loaders only fix the 6 shot 357 mag. I will keep working with this loader to see if it will load better as times go on. However, moon clips work the best for me at this time.

There are not many speed loaders for the S&W 327, but speed beez nails it for the most part. They are not ideal for pocket carry, due to lack of a locking system, but they seem to be faster in that reguard, no mechanism to fumble with. Just align and slap it home and get back to business. The only gripe I have is with the rounds tightness tolerances in the loader were higher. Getting them aligned under stress can be a chore on that cylinder, but with practice you'll get used to the slop. I feel these were made for competitive shooters, so for edc, you may want to look at one of the other companies but all in all, they work well.
